The Earth rotates on a slowly-changing axis. Any star that appears very near this axis will seem to remain in place while the Earth turns.
As the axis itself changes, so will the North Star. Today it's Polaris, but 12,000 years from now will be Vega.
Due to the mostly uniform rotation of the earth, the stars in the night sky appear to orbit the celestial pole. Polaris, the North Star, is between 1 and 2 degrees off the celestial pole, so it too moves as the night progresses, but the movement is so slight that it is imperceptible to the human eye. Consequently, Polaris has not always been the North Pole Star. Due to a phenomenon called axial precession, the North Pole Star changes, though this change takes thousands of years to complete, and Polaris will be our North Star for the foreseeable future.
